LinuxParty
En un mundo donde la World Wide Web (WWW) se ha convertido en una parte esencial de la vida diaria, es fascinante explorar la primera página web de la historia y comprender su impacto en el mundo digital. Ambos, la creación de la primera página web y la concepción de la WWW, son atribuibles al científico británico Tim Berners-Lee, quien en ese entonces era investigador en el prestigioso Laboratorio Europeo de Física de Partículas (CERN) en Ginebra.
El 20 de diciembre de 1990, aparentemente un día común, marcó el inicio de una herramienta que todavía hoy permite compartir información globalmente mediante una sencilla arquitectura basada en documentos y enlaces, conocida como 'hipertexto'.
Leer más: La Primera Página Web de la Historia, una Reliquia Digital que Podría ser Patrimonio de la Humanidad Escribir un comentario
Un profesor de religión en la Universidad de Columbia escribe: "No creo que los seres humanos sean la última etapa del proceso evolutivo". Lo que venga después no será ni simplemente orgánico ni simplemente maquínico, sino que será el resultado de la relación cada vez más simbiótica entre los seres humanos y la tecnología. Unidos como parásito/huésped, ni las personas ni las tecnologías pueden existir separadas unas de otras porque son prótesis constitutivas unas de otras... La llamada inteligencia "artificial" es la última extensión del proceso emergente a través del cual la vida toma formas cada vez más diversas. y formas complejas.
El artículo enumera "cuatro trayectorias que serán cada vez más importantes para la relación simbiótica entre humanos y máquinas".
La serie de kernel Linux 6.6 recibirá actualizaciones de mantenimiento con correcciones de errores y seguridad durante los próximos tres años.

En otro giro inesperado de los acontecimientos, la última serie de kernel Linux 6.6 ha sido marcada oficialmente como LTS (Long Term Support) en el sitio web kernel.org con una esperanza de vida prevista de al menos tres años.
El kernel de Linux 6.6 se lanzó a finales de octubre de 2023 e introduce nuevas funciones como compatibilidad con Intel Shadow Stack, un nuevo programador de tareas llamado EEVDF, compatibilidad mejorada con dispositivos Lenovo IdeaPad, HP y ASUS, compatibilidad con dispositivos USB MIDI 2 y Numerosos controladores nuevos y actualizados para un mejor soporte de hardware.
Óscar Viñals, un destacado diseñador industrial catalán, continúa marcando pauta en el diseño de aeronaves futuristas con su última creación, el Sky OV. Tras sorprendernos con el Flash Falcon, un avión propulsado por fusión nuclear, ahora nos presenta este innovador avión supersónico que busca transformar la aviación comercial haciéndola más eficiente, veloz y sostenible. Su revolucionario diseño en forma de V y su motor de detonación alimentado con hidrógeno son las claves de este proyecto.
El motor de detonación por impulsos, explicado por Viñals como un dispositivo de propulsión que utiliza explosiones controladas para generar empuje, se ha ideado para impulsar aviones supersónicos. En teoría, estos motores son más eficientes a altas velocidades, pudiendo alcanzar hasta cuatro o cinco veces la velocidad del sonido.
En el mundo de la informática y la programación, a menudo nos encontramos con la necesidad de comparar archivos para identificar diferencias entre ellos. En entornos basados en Linux, existe una herramienta poderosa llamada diff
que facilita esta tarea. En este artículo, exploraremos cómo utilizar diff
para comparar dos archivos, específicamente en el contexto de buscar contenido que falta en uno de ellos.
Sección 1: ¿Qué es diff
? diff
es una herramienta de línea de comandos en sistemas basados en Unix y Linux que compara dos archivos línea por línea y muestra las diferencias. Su funcionalidad principal es resaltar las líneas que son diferentes entre dos archivos.
En una era de avances tecnológicos sin precedentes, las herramientas de IA generativa están redefiniendo los límites de la creatividad y el desarrollo de software. Un ejemplo notable es "Angry Pumpkins", un videojuego desarrollado en pocos días por el español Javier López, quien logró esta hazaña sin escribir una sola línea de código, utilizando exclusivamente 'prompts' para generar las imágenes.
López, fundador y ex CEO de Erasmusu, se sumergió en el potencial de GPT-4 y las capacidades gráficas de Midjourney y DALL•E 3 para materializar su videojuego de manera única y revolucionaria.
A medida que avanza la construcción del reactor nuclear ITER en Francia, un proyecto en el que España también está involucrada, Japón ha demostrado un significativo avance en la viabilidad de la fusión nuclear como fuente de energía. El recién activado reactor JT-60SA japonés ha logrado mantener la reacción durante períodos más prolongados que sus predecesores, marcando un paso importante hacia la realización de la energía de fusión como una fuente sostenible.
El nuevo reactor JT-60SA, que sirve como un preludio al colosal ITER en construcción en Francia, fue puesto en funcionamiento la semana pasada, evidenciando la eficacia de su maquinaria, que en Europa será el doble de grande.
Los sistemas de gestión de configuración están diseñados para facilitar el control de una gran cantidad de servidores a los administradores y equipos de operaciones. Le permiten controlar muchos sistemas diferentes de forma automatizada desde una ubicación central. Si bien hay muchos sistemas populares de gestión de configuración disponibles para sistemas Linux, como Chef y Puppet, estos suelen ser más complejos de lo que mucha gente quiere o necesita. Ansible es una excelente alternativa a estas opciones porque tiene una sobrecarga mucho menor para comenzar.
Ansible funciona configurando máquinas cliente desde una computadora con componentes de Ansible instalados y configurados. Se comunica a través de canales SSH normales para recuperar información de máquinas remotas, emitir comandos y copiar archivos. Debido a esto, un sistema Ansible no requiere la instalación de ningún software adicional en las computadoras cliente. Esta es una forma en que Ansible simplifica la administración de servidores. Cualquier servidor que tenga un puerto SSH expuesto puede incluirse bajo el paraguas de configuración de Ansible, independientemente de en qué etapa de su ciclo de vida se encuentre.
Ansible adopta un enfoque modular, lo que facilita su ampliación para utilizar las funcionalidades del sistema principal para abordar escenarios específicos. Los módulos se pueden escribir en cualquier idioma y comunicarse en JSON estándar. Los archivos de configuración se escriben principalmente en el formato de serialización de datos YAML debido a su naturaleza expresiva y su similitud con los lenguajes de marcado populares. Ansible puede interactuar con los clientes a través de herramientas de línea de comandos o mediante sus scripts de configuración llamados Playbooks.
En esta guía, instalará Ansible en un servidor CentOS pero es extensible a las versiones de RedHat, AlmaLinux, RockyLinux y Fedora y aprenderá algunos conceptos básicos sobre cómo usar el software.
OpenMRS es un eficiente sistema de almacenamiento y recuperación de registros médicos electrónicos (EMR) lanzado como software de código abierto. Ayuda a brindar atención médica en los países en desarrollo para tratar a millones de pacientes con VIH/SIDA y tuberculosis (TB). Se basa en los principios de apertura para intercambiar datos de pacientes con otros sistemas de información médica. Puede administrar todos los registros médicos electrónicos a través de la interfaz web OpenMRS.
Este tutorial explicará cómo instalar el software OpenMRS en Ubuntu.
Requisitos previos
- Un servidor que ejecute al menos un Linux Ubuntu 22.04.
- Se configura una contraseña de root en el servidor.
Instalar OpenJDK 8
OpenMRS es una aplicación basada en Java y solo admite la versión 8 de Java. Por lo tanto, deberá instalar Java 8 en su servidor. Puede instalarlo usando el siguiente comando.
apt install openjdk-8-jdk
A continuación, verifique la versión de Java usando el siguiente comando:
java -version
Obtendrá el siguiente resultado:
openjdk version "1.8.0_352" OpenJDK Runtime Environment (build 1.8.0_352-8u352-ga-1~22.04-b08) OpenJDK 64-Bit Server VM (build 25.352-b08, mixed mode)
-
Artículos
- Trabajos Remotos Atractivos para Desarrolladores ganando hasta 9000 euros al mes.
- Alternativas a Plesk y cPanel: los 10 mejores paneles gratuitos de alojamiento web de código abierto
- 3 herramientas de línea de comandos para instalar paquetes Deb en Ubuntu, Debian y Linux Mint
- AlmaLinux se une a openQA para mejorar las pruebas automatizadas en Linux
- Comer tarde por la noche aumenta el hambre y el riesgo de aumento de peso, según un estudio
- Marruecos apuesta fuerte por la automoción propia con vehículos de hidrógeno 'made in Morocco'
- NYT: Este es el fin de la programación tal como la conocemos
- GEN-2: La nueva IA que transforma texto en videos asombrosos de manera gratuita
- Mr. Bean, el actor Rowan Atkinson, expresa preocupaciones sobre la electrificación y aboga por el desarrollo de combustibles sintéticos
- Instale el panel de alojamiento web EHCP en Ubuntu 12.04 / 12.10 / 13.04 / 13.10 / 14.04
- Elon Musk besó un Robot: un truco de relaciones públicas o un vistazo al futuro de la tecnología?
- Las 7 mejores aplicaciones para instalar en su instancia de Nextcloud